1. Start With the Style That Matches Your Home
Accent chairs come in a huge range of silhouettes, and the right one depends on the overall design language of your space. A few popular categories for UAE homes:
- Wingback chairs — classic, tall-backed, and formal. Ideal for majlis-style seating areas, traditional living rooms, or as a statement piece in a Jumeirah villa.
- Barrel and cuddle chairs — rounded, plush, and contemporary. These work beautifully in modern apartments across Downtown Dubai or Business Bay where soft curves soften an otherwise minimalist layout.
- Armchairs with carved wood detailing — a nod to more ornate, traditional aesthetics, often chosen for formal sitting rooms or entryways.
If you already have a strong design direction — say, a neutral, minimalist living room in a Saadiyat Island apartment — a rounded barrel chair in a soft fabric can add warmth without disrupting the clean lines. If your home leans traditional, a tufted wingback chair brings elegance and structure.
2. Pick a Fabric That Suits the UAE Climate
Temperature and humidity matter more than most people expect when choosing upholstery. Villas with large windows facing the sun can see significant heat build-up in a room, and fabric choice affects both comfort and longevity.
- Velvet looks luxurious and photographs beautifully, but it can feel warm to sit on in peak summer — better suited to air-conditioned interiors used mainly in the evening.
- Linen and cotton blends breathe well and suit sunrooms, balconies-adjacent seating, or bright open-plan spaces.
- Performance and stain-resistant fabrics are worth considering for family homes in Sharjah or Ajman where kids, pets, or frequent guests are part of daily life.
Whatever fabric you choose, check that the frame underneath is solid wood rather than particleboard — humidity swings across the year can warp weaker materials over time, while solid teak or acacia wood frames hold up far better long-term.
3. Think About Size and Placement Before You Buy
Accent chairs are meant to complement a room, not overwhelm it. Before ordering, measure the space where the chair will sit and leave at least 60–90 cm of walkway clearance around it. A few placement ideas that work well in UAE homes:
- A single chair angled beside a sofa to create a natural conversation nook — popular in open-plan villas in Arabian Ranches or The Springs.
- A pair of matching chairs flanking a coffee table for symmetry in larger majlis-style living rooms.
- One statement chair in a bedroom corner or reading nook — a favourite layout in apartments across JVC and Dubai Marina where space is at a premium.
For smaller apartments, a chair with slim, tapered legs will visually open up the room compared to a heavy, boxy base. If you are furnishing a compact studio, consider a chair that can also fold out or double as extra seating when guests visit.
4. Match Comfort to How You'll Actually Use It
Some accent chairs are chosen purely for looks, while others need to earn their place as a genuinely comfortable everyday seat. If it is going in a reading corner or a spot where you will spend real time, prioritise:
- Seat depth and back height — taller wing chairs with a footrest option suit longer lounging sessions.
- Cushion density — firmer foam holds its shape longer in daily use, especially in family households.
- Armrest height — comfortable for reading, working on a laptop, or simply relaxing after a long day.
